Lipoxins are trihydroxytetraene metabolites derived from arachidonic acid through an interaction between lipoxygenases with C-5 and C-15 specificities. Lipoxin A4 (LXA4) inhibits the chemotactic responsiveness of polymorphonuclear (PMN) neutrophils to leukotriene B4 and to the peptide formyl-methionyl-leucyl-phenylalanine (fMLP).{14813} 5(S),6(R)-7-trihydroxymethyl Heptanoate is a C-7 truncated analog of lipoxin A4 (LXA4) that is equiactive as LXA4 in the inhibition of leukotriene B4 (LTB4)-induced polymorphonuclear neutrophils (PMN) chemotaxis with an IC50 value of 5nM.{14813}
